Multichannel potential-time measurements were carried out in cultures of Escherichia coli growing in the presence of increasing amounts of aminoglycoside antibiotics. The potentiometric lag times were an increasing function of the drug concentration. Theoretical apparent growth rates of organisms in the presence of the drug could be calculated from these potential-time data, and were related to the antibiotic concentration. For each antibiotic tested, it was possible to determine an inhibitation rate constant as a function of the drug concentration, which characterized the bactericidal efficacity of the drug. A potentiometric MIC (minimal inhibitory concentration) was defined as the concentration at which the inhibition rate constant would be equal to the specific growth rate of organisms with no drugs added to the culture broth: the potentiometric MIC values were consistent with the conventional MIC's determined by a standard diffusion technique.
